The highly anticipated return of Ronda Rousey to the MMA scene has set the stage for an intriguing showdown with Gina Carano, a former champion herself. This clash of titans, set to take place on Netflix's first MMA event, promises to be a historic moment in the sport.
As I delve into this topic, it's fascinating to witness the transformation of these two iconic figures. Rousey, a UFC Hall of Famer, is making a comeback after nearly a decade, while Carano, who last fought in 2009, is stepping back into the ring. Their initial faceoff, which took place on March 10th, was marked by a friendly atmosphere, but as seen in the recent press conference, the dynamics have shifted.

The Promoter's Role
The event, promoted by Most Valuable Promotions, adds an interesting layer to the narrative. This promoter, known for its involvement in high-profile boxing matches, is now venturing into the world of MMA. Their decision to showcase this fight on Netflix further emphasizes the growing popularity and mainstream appeal of MMA.
